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Carlsberg Station to Nyhavn is to train which costs 5 kr - 9 kr and takes 9 min.
The fastest way to get from Carlsberg Station to Nyhavn is to taxi which takes 6 min and costs 130 kr - 160 kr.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Sønder Boulevard and arriving at Store Kongensgade. Services depart every 30 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 21 min.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Carlsberg St. and arriving at Nørreport St.. Services depart every 10 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 9 min.
The distance between Carlsberg Station and Nyhavn is 4 km.
The best way to get from Carlsberg Station to Nyhavn without a car is to train which takes 9 min and costs 5 kr - 9 kr.
The train from Carlsberg St. to Nørreport St. takes 9 min including transfers and departs every 10 minutes.
Carlsberg Station to Nyhavn bus services, operated by Movia, depart from Sønder Boulevard station.
Carlsberg Station to Nyhavn train services, operated by Danish Railways (DSB), depart from Carlsberg St. station.
The best way to get from Carlsberg Station to Nyhavn is to train which takes 9 min and costs 5 kr - 9 kr. Alternatively, you can line 23 bus, which costs 18 kr - 25 kr and takes 25 min.
What companies run services between Carlsberg Station, Denmark and Nyhavn, Capital Region, Denmark?
Danish Railways (DSB) operates a train from Carlsberg St. to Nørreport St. every 10 minutes. Tickets cost kr 5–9 and the journey takes 9 min. Alternatively, Movia operates a bus from Sønder Boulevard to Store Kongensgade every 30 minutes. Tickets cost kr 18–25 and the journey takes 21 min.
